What Is a Happy Ending Massage?
A happy ending massage refers to a massage session that concludes with sexual release or orgasm, typically provided through manual genital stimulation. This practice starts as a standard massage focused on relaxation and muscle relief but transitions into an erotic interaction. While the term is widely recognized in pop culture, it is important to distinguish happy ending massages from licensed therapeutic massage, as the inclusion of sexual activity raises numerous health, ethical, and legal considerations.
Happy ending massages exist in a legal gray area in many regions and are often associated with unregulated businesses. While some people seek them for perceived relaxation or pleasure, others warn of emotional, relational, and medical risks. Understanding the implications—including consent, boundaries, and local law—is crucial for anyone considering or curious about this practice.

How Is a Happy Ending Massage Typically Experienced?
A happy ending massage usually begins as a standard relaxation or therapeutic session—with kneading of muscles, application of oils, and focus on tension relief. At some point (often after implicit or explicit agreement), the session transitions to sexual stimulation, most commonly through manual genital touch culminating in orgasm.
Key Point: This type of massage shifts from a wellness focus to an erotic or sexual one, fundamentally changing the nature of the encounter from therapeutic to intimate or transactional.
Important distinctions:
- Slang vs. Clinical: "Happy ending massage" is an informal, slang term—not used by reputable or licensed massage therapists. In professional circles, any form of sexual activity as part of a massage is an ethics violation.
- Setting: These services are typically found in unregulated or clandestine establishments, sometimes presented under euphemistic advertising.
- Nature of service: The outcome is not just physical relief but may also involve emotional, psychological, or social consequences.
Example scenario (kept non-explicit): A man books a session at a massage parlor where erotic massage is discreetly offered. After an initial back and neck massage, the practitioner may inquire about additional services or proceed only if there is clear, mutual consent. The session may conclude with sexual stimulation, after which the client leaves—often with a mix of physical relaxation and complex emotions regarding privacy, legality, or personal boundaries.
Historical and Cultural Context
Massage has been used for centuries across cultures for healing, relaxation, and ritual purposes. In certain ancient societies—including Tantric practices originating from South Asia—sensual and erotic elements were sometimes incorporated into spiritual or healing ceremonies. However, the specific modern concept of a "happy ending massage" as a commercial, transactional service is much more recent and culturally specific.
- Modern emergence: The phrase and practice gained popularity in the 20th century alongside shifts in sexual openness and adult entertainment.
- Cultural differences: Some countries or regions have more permissive attitudes toward erotic massage, viewing it as a personal or even therapeutic choice. Others strictly prohibit any sexual elements in massage.
- Stigma and secrecy: Despite being widely referenced, many people feel shame or embarrassment around the topic, resulting in social stigma and legal attempts to curb such businesses.
Did you know? In many jurisdictions, law enforcement periodically conducts undercover investigations of massage parlors to enforce anti-prostitution laws and protect against human trafficking.

Risks, Downsides, and Harms Associated With Happy Ending Massage
While some people highlight potential benefits, the risks and limitations are significant:
Physical Health Risks
- STIs: While manual stimulation is relatively lower risk than intercourse, transmission of herpes, HPV, or other skin-to-skin infections is possible CDC.
- Injury: Rough or unskilled touch can cause bruising, soreness, or even minor genital trauma.
Psychological and Relational Risks
- Guilt, Shame, Secrecy: Many experience regret, anxiety, or distress—especially if the experience conflicts with personal or cultural values.
- Relationship Fallout: Discovery by a partner may cause major breaches of trust or relationship breakdown.
- Emotional detachment: The transactional or impersonal nature may lead to feelings of isolation rather than true intimacy.
Legal and Ethical Risks
- Criminal penalties: In many places, paying for sexual services is illegal; conviction can result in fines, jail time, or lasting legal consequences.
- Human trafficking concerns: Some unregulated establishments are linked with worker exploitation, heightening ethical concerns WHO Sexual Health Guidelines.
Social Risks
- Stigma: Use of erotic massage services may provoke judgment from peers or communities.
- Employment concerns: Legal trouble or publicity around such services can impact careers or professional licenses.

Interaction With Medical or Psychological Conditions
Some men considering a happy ending massage may be managing existing health issues:
- Erectile dysfunction (ED): Erotic massage may temporarily boost erection confidence for some, but not address underlying causes Integrative Approaches to Men’s Sexual Health.
- Anxiety or depression: Short-term relaxation is possible, but secrecy or shame can worsen mental health symptoms over time, especially if at odds with personal values Smith et al. 2020.
- History of trauma: Erotic touch, when unwanted or boundary-crossing, may trigger trauma responses; seeking trauma-informed providers or therapy is vital.
- Prostate health: Direct prostate massage is sometimes incorporated, but this should only be performed by someone specifically trained—improper technique may risk injury or infection. Always consult a healthcare provider regarding prostate concerns.
Did you know? Men with cardiovascular risks should approach any vigorous sexual activity cautiously; consult your doctor if you have recent cardiac symptoms.
